2-Methyltriethylenediamine (2-methyl-TEDA) is a gelling amine catalyst for polyurethane — a methylated triethylenediamine variant of the benchmark DABCO catalyst with a modified activity profile. Identity: CAS 1193-66-4.
What it is
2-Methyltriethylenediamine (CAS 1193-66-4, 2-methyl-1,4-diazabicyclo[2.2.2]octane) is a bicyclic diamine, the methyl-substituted analogue of TEDA. It is commonly supplied in solution.
How it catalyzes
It catalyzes the gel (urethane) reaction like TEDA, with the methyl substituent modifying basicity and selectivity. Balanced with a blowing catalyst to tune the foam.
Applications
It is used in flexible and rigid polyurethane foam and CASE as a gelling catalyst, with a blowing co-catalyst. The parent is TEDA.

Typical Properties
Typical reference values, not a specification; the Certificate of Analysis (CoA) for the lot governs.
| Property | Typical Value |
|---|---|
| Chemical / class | Polyurethane gelling catalyst (bicyclic amine) |
| Catalyst action | Gelling |
| CAS Number | 1193-66-4 |
| Molecular Formula | C7H14N2 |
| Molecular Weight | 126.20 g/mol |
| Handling | Refer to the current SDS |
